Osteosarcoma of the pelvis
D Donati1, S Giacomini, E Gozzi
1Department of Musculoskeletal Oncology and Orthopaedic Surgery, Istituto Ortopedico Rizzoli, Via Pupilli 1, 40136 Bologna, Italy. davide.donati@ior.it
Summary
Outcomes for pelvic osteosarcoma patients are poor, with limited local control despite aggressive treatment. Tumor necrosis, however, indicates a better prognosis for these rare bone cancers.

Background:
- Pelvic osteosarcoma is a rare and aggressive bone malignancy.
- Treatment strategies and outcomes require further elucidation.
Purpose of the Study:
- To report outcomes for a significant cohort of pelvic osteosarcoma patients.
- To establish guidelines for optimal treatment of this condition.
Main Methods:
- Retrospective review of 60 consecutive patients with primary high-grade pelvic osteosarcoma.
- Analysis of tumor location, surgical interventions, and survival data.
Main Results:
- High rates of metastasis led to universal mortality in affected patients.
- Despite wide surgical margins in 18 cases, local recurrence occurred in eight.
- Overall survival was poor, with only eight patients alive at the end of the study.
Conclusions:
- Intensive chemotherapy and wide surgical margins show limited efficacy in achieving local control.
- Tumor necrosis is a significant positive prognostic indicator.
- Amputation should be considered when internal hemipelvectomy is insufficient, especially in cases involving sciatic nerve roots or in elderly patients.

Rous Sarcoma Virus (RSV) and Cancer
Rous Sarcoma virus or RSV was discovered by F. Peyton Rous in the year 1911 as a filterable transmissible agent that could cause tumors in chickens. He won a Nobel Prize for this discovery in 1966. His experiments clearly demonstrated that some cancers could be caused by infectious agents and led to the discovery of many more cancer-causing viruses in animals as well as humans.
